(±)-α-Amino-γ-butyrolactone hydrobromide
(±)-α-Amino-γ-butyrolactone hydrobromide (CAS 6305-38-0), with the molecular formula C4H7NO2 · HBr and a molecular weight of 182.02 g/mol, is a valuable chemical intermediate. This amino acid derivative is primarily utilised in chemical synthesis and research. Its specific structure lends itself to various applications within the fields of peptide chemistry and biochemical studies, making it a key reagent for advanced laboratory work.

| Molecular weight | 182.02 |
|---|---|
| Empirical formula | C4H7NO2 · HBr |
| Assay | 99% |
| Melting point | 220-225 °C(lit.) |

Hazard statements
- H315Causes skin irritation
- H319Causes serious eye irritation
- H335May cause respiratory irritation
Precautionary statements
- P261Avoid breathing dust, fume, gas or vapours
- P305IF IN EYES
| Protective equipment | dust mask type N95 (US), Eyeshields, Gloves |
|---|---|
| Water hazard class (WGK, DE) | 3 |
| Hazard codes (EU) | Xi |
| Risk statements (R) | 36/37/38 |
| Safety statements (S) | 26-36 |
Hazard information is provided for guidance. Always consult the product Safety Data Sheet (SDS), available on request, before handling.
